[发明专利]用于对表面进行导航的方法和装置有效
申请号: | 200710302308.1 | 申请日: | 2007-12-18 |
公开(公告)号: | CN101206541A | 公开(公告)日: | 2008-06-25 |
发明(设计)人: | 曾来福;斯里尼瓦桑·拉克什曼阿曼 | 申请(专利权)人: | 安华高科技ECBUIP(新加坡)私人有限公司 |
主分类号: | G06F3/033 | 分类号: | G06F3/033;G06F3/038 |
代理公司: | 北京东方亿思知识产权代理有限责任公司 | 代理人: | 柳春雷 |
地址: | 新加坡*** | 国省代码: | 新加坡;SG |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 用于 表面 进行 导航 方法 装置 | ||
技术领域
本发明涉及用于对表面进行导航的方法和装置。
背景技术
早期的光学计算机鼠标利用基于散斑(speckle)的光传感器来检测从表面反射的光。例如,计算机鼠标可能利用多组垂直定向地布置的光电二极管来生成与鼠标在表面上的移动相对应的x方向和y方向时变输出。然后这些输出可以被中继到计算机系统,以使得计算机系统可以确定鼠标关于表面的相对移动。
最近,光学计算机鼠标已利用基于图像的光传感器来检测从表面反射的光。例如,计算机鼠标可能获得从表面反射的光的相继图像。然后,导航引擎(通常在鼠标上)将比较所述图像的相继图像,以生成与鼠标在表面上的移动相对应的时变的x方向和y方向输出。
附图说明
本发明的说明性实施例在附图中图示,其中:
图1图示了用于对表面进行导航的第一示例性方法;
图2图示了用于对表面进行导航的示例性装置,该装置可以实现图1所示的方法;
图3图示了图2所示装置的导航传感器的示例性元件;
图4图示了具有计算机鼠标形状因子的外壳,图2所示装置的元件可以安装在该外壳中;
图5图示了用于对表面进行导航的第二示例性方法;
图6图示了用于对表面进行导航的第二示例性装置,该装置可以实现图5所示的方法;以及
图7图示了图6所示装置的导航传感器的示例性元件。
具体实施方式
在以下的说明书和附图中,出现在不同附图中的相似标号用于表示相似元件或方法步骤。
与采用基于散斑的光传感器的鼠标相比,采用基于图像的光传感器的光学计算机鼠标更受欢迎。这是因为基于图像的光传感器及其相关联的导航引擎通常能够1)对更多的表面进行导航(或者跟踪),并且2)更加精确地导航(即,具有更高的分辨率)。但是,尽管基于图像的光传感器在大多数表面上具有出众的导航能力,但是它们在诸如玻璃表面之类的一些表面上可能表现拙劣。这是因为玻璃表面通常很光滑,很少有表面瑕疵来以不同的角度对光进行散射。因此,玻璃表面趋于反射相干光,而不是散射光,并且与基于图像的光传感器相关联的导航引擎难以找到足够的图像特征来可靠地比较两个相继表面图像之间的差异。而且通常,如果图像中可检测的特征少于最小数目,则导航引擎被编程为将图像看作“噪声”,并且不对鼠标移动发出信号。
为了改善光学计算机鼠标(或者任何其他光学导航设备)的导航性能,在这里建议提供一种导航设备,其具有不同类型的第一和第二光传感器,并且根据哪个光传感器对于特定表面提供更好的性能而在利用一个或另一个光传感器之间切换。
根据本发明,图1图示了用于对表面进行导航的示例性方法100。方法100利用安装到导航设备的第一光传感器来检测从表面反射的光(见框104)。然后,随时间变化的第一光传感器的输出被用于确定导航设备关于表面的相对移动(见框106)。在利用第一光传感器期间,确定随时间变化的第一光传感器的输出是否指示导航设备关于表面的移动(见框108)。如果结果为否,则安装到导航设备的与第一光传感器不同类型的第二光传感器被用于检测从表面反射的光(见框110)。然后,随时间变化的第二光传感器的输出被用于确定导航设备关于表面的相对移动(见框112)。
在方法100的一个实施例中,可以确定随时间变化的第二光传感器的输出是否指示导航设备关于表面的移动(见框114)。如果结果为否,则方法100可以返回到利用第一光传感器的输出来确定是否存在导航设备关于表面的相对移动的步骤。在方法100的同一实施例中(或者在不同实施例中),第一光传感器可以被用作缺省的光传感器。方法100然后可以对第二光传感器的输出有多长时间被用于确定导航设备关于表面的相对移动进行计时(见框116),在预定时间之后,方法100可以返回到利用第一光传感器的输出来确定是否存在导航设备关于表面的相对移动的步骤(见框118)。
在一些情况下,只要对导航设备的移动进行的检测存在故障,就可以切换用于确定导航设备的移动的光传感器。但是,在方法100的优选实施例中,仅在未检测到移动的时间经过了时间段(t)之后才切换光传感器。时间段(t)的长度可以被调整,以便1)减少光传感器的不必要切换,而2)确保计算机或导航设备用户不会注意到时间段(t)。
可选地,方法100可以包括利用一个或多个安装到导航设备的光源来照亮受到导航的表面(见框102)。根据特定导航设备的配置,可以连续地激活(一个或多个)光源,或者仅在第一和第二光传感器的激活期间激活(一个或多个)光源,或者与第一和第二光传感器同步地激活(一个或多个)光源。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于安华高科技ECBUIP(新加坡)私人有限公司,未经安华高科技ECBUIP(新加坡)私人有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/200710302308.1/2.html,转载请声明来源钻瓜专利网。
- 上一篇:一种二位二通流体控制阀
- 下一篇:利用环迭代结构生成消息摘要的方法和装置